> I think sometimes it depends on the CD quality. I could not start ubuntu
> Live Cd from a magazine  CD and yes from the Official ShipIt Live Cd 
> (although I have the bad fortune I cannot use my Huawei E220
> out-of-the-box).

It very much depends on CD quality.  The quantity of data on the Ubuntu
images pushes the limit of what you can do with a CD, and I have had no end
of trouble writing iso images to CDs.  Good media should work, bad media
never do. I finally started using DVDs for less stress.
